Responsibilities

  • Manage all phases of roadway and utility infrastructure programs-from planning and design through construction and closeout.
  • Oversee roadway geometry, pavement design, drainage systems, and traffic control plans.
  • Ensure compliance with FDOT and municipal standards during design and construction phases.
  • Coordinate water, sewer, stormwater, and other utility systems within roadway projects.
  • Work with utility providers to manage relocations and minimize service disruptions.
  • Serve as the primary liaison with clients, regulatory agencies, and community partners.
  • Develop and monitor budgets, schedules, and performance metrics; implement corrective actions as needed.
  • Identify risks, implement mitigation strategies, and resolve issues proactively.
  • Identify and resolve design, construction, and utility conflicts proactively.
  • Mentor project managers, engineers, and support staff to foster a collaborative, high-performance culture.
